‘Hajji Firuz’ carnival in Qazvin

QAZVIN, Apr. 01 (MNA) – Upon Nowruz's arrival, Hajji Firuz, who is a fictional character in Iranian folklore appears in the streets, entertaining passers-by via singing traditional songs, dancing, and playing his tambourine.
